What makes the SmartScope in this kit special is that it is equipped with a number of headers that provide access to all important signals in the SmartScope. ![]() Elektor is now offering the unique SmartScope Maker Kit, which includes a special version of the SmartScope and two programmers with suitable cables. Internally the SmartScope is built around a powerful Xilinx Spartan 6 FPGA, which also makes it suitable for use as an FPGA development platform. ![]() The user interface of the software is based on a totally new concept, and the standard software includes several decoders for digital signal protocols. For instance, it is compatible with most operating systems and can be connected to a desktop, laptop, tablet or smartphone. The SmartScope is an especially handy and affordable USB oscilloscope, logic analyzer and signal generator with a number of remarkable features.
